Discovering Crete: The Heart of the Mediterranean Diet

An Enriching Journey Begins

Nestled in the azure waters of the Mediterranean, Crete stands as a beacon of culinary heritage and vibrant culture. In the latest episode of My Greek Table, hosted by the passionate Diane Kochilas, viewers embark on an enlightening journey that captures the essence of Crete and its invaluable contribution to the Mediterranean Diet. This island is not just a geographical location; it’s the heart of a lifestyle that emphasizes health, well-being, and delicious eating.

The Role of Seafood

Surrounded by the stunning Mediterranean Sea, Crete boasts an incredible array of seafood that further enriches the local diet. Diane samples various dishes featuring fresh catch that emphasizes the island’s coastal culinary traditions. Rich in omega-3 fatty acids, seafood plays an important role in the Mediterranean Diet, promoting heart health and overall well-being.
